South
A term that typically refers to the southeastern and south-central regions of the United States, often characterized by its distinct cultural, historical, and economic traits.
Tenant Farmers
Farmers who rent land to grow crops, rather than owning the land themselves.
Individual's Freedom
The rights and liberties that allow an individual to act, speak, think, and pursue happiness without undue interference or restriction from others or the government.
Attack On Fort Sumter
The bombardment and surrender of Fort Sumter in Charleston Harbor on April 12, 1861, marking the beginning of the American Civil War.
